Andy Cohen is a father of two!

The Watch What Happens Live star took to Instagram on April 29 to announce the arrival of his second child, a baby girl, who he welcomed via surrogate.

"HERE'S LUCY!!!!!," Andy wrote. "Meet my daughter, Lucy Eve Cohen! She's 8 pounds 13 oz and was born at 5:13 pm in New York City!!!"

Her name seems to pay homage to Andy's parents, Lou and Evelyn Cohen.

Lucy joins Andy's son Benjamin Cohen, 3, who was born via surrogate in February 2019. And how does Benjamin feel about the family's latest addition? As Andy revealed on Instagram, "Her big brother can't wait to meet her!"

Andy went on to thank the surrogate who carried Lucy.

"Thank you to my rock star surrogate (ALL surrogates are rockstars, by the way) and everyone who helped make this miracle happen," he noted. "I'm so happy."

Back in August 2021, Andy gave E! News an exclusive update on his plans to expand his family.

"You know, I'm working on it," Andy teased during E! News' Daily Pop. "It turns out it takes a long time to make a baby. I'm definitely open to it and I would love to see it happen soon."

Now with his new bundle of joy, it seems "soon" has officially arrived.

Prior to Lucy's arrival, Andy opened up about how becoming a father changed "everything" for him.

"It's amazing," Andy said of Benjamin's arrival during a June 2019 episode of Late Night With Seth Meyers. "He's a little lovebug."

The TV personality has also called Benjamin's birth an "incredible" experience.

"He wasn't crying," he recalled on Today in 2019. "His eyes were open, and we just stared at each other for about two hours, just looking at each other, and he was touching my face….it was just incredible, and I was hoping he was going to have a little hair on his head, and the kid's already over delivering."

Andy went on to acknowledge that while it wasn't an easy ride, he was overjoyed to become a dad.

"It's not that easy for a single guy to do this on his own," he said at the time. "It takes a village, as they say so I really wanted him, and the fact that he's here and he's so perfect and he's in wonderful health and I have great gratitude for my surrogate and all the people who helped me get to this place and I'm just thrilled."
